You would always remember the day of the incident, as if it was yesterday... You thought it would be the last day of your short and tough life. But you were wrong, oh you were SO wrong...

Because on that day, your life changed forever within seconds. In a battle between you and a handful of toxic monsters, your victory was considered sure. But there was one fatal moment, in which one of the hateful beasts got you at your weaker feet and crushed you down in an instant. It was not really a fault of your skills or ability for fighting, it was only a very unlucky coincidence and the nature of the toxin within the claws of the monsters.

The next thing you could remember was the breath-taking and overwhelming pain of the injury and the charge of the pack. Before you could see the white tunnel, indicating the end of your life, your surroundings and your consciousness had turned black.
